Greater Noida: The confluence of large-scale infrastructure deployment and robust institutional interest has repositioned Greater Noida as a premier tier-one destination for Greater Noida property investment. As of March 2026, the operationalization of the Jewar International Airport has catalyzed a massive re-rating of capital values across the residential and commercial sectors. Data indicates that land values in core sectors have appreciated by up to 120% over the preceding 36-month period, driven by a strategic shift toward planned urban expansion.

Infrastructure Catalysts for Greater Noida Property Investment

The acceleration of capital values in the region is fundamentally linked to the completion of multi-modal connectivity projects that integrate the city with the wider National Capital Region. The six-lane Noida–Greater Noida Expressway remains the primary arterial corridor, while the Eastern Peripheral Expressway has successfully diverted heavy transit traffic, enhancing the local environment for premium residential development.

Capital Appreciation Trends in Established Residential Sectors

The Alpha and Beta sectors have emerged as the primary beneficiaries of the recent Greater Noida property investment boom. Beta 1 has recorded a notable 120% surge in land values, with residential plot prices now ranging between ₹1.5 crore and ₹4.6 crore depending on the specific location and road width. In Alpha 1, the market has transitioned toward ready-to-move inventory, with 3BHK configurations commanding between ₹1 crore and ₹2 crore. The proximity to the Alpha 1 Metro Station, a mere three-minute walk for many residents, has sustained high occupancy levels and rental yields. Educational institutions like St Joseph's School and healthcare facilities such as Kailash Hospital, located within a 2 km radius, provide the necessary social infrastructure to support these valuations.

Luxury Housing Demand in the Jaypee Greens Micro-market

High-net-worth individuals and institutional investors are increasingly focusing on the Jaypee Greens corridor, where the market is witnessing a shift toward ultra-luxury inventory. The Islands by Gaurs and CRC The Peridona have set new benchmarks in the region, with ticket sizes for premium 4BHK and 5BHK units reaching as high as ₹27 crore. This segment has benefited from established golf-centric infrastructure and superior maintenance standards provided by the developer.

Emerging Value Corridors: Delta and Gamma Sector Analysis

The Delta and Gamma sectors offer a distinct investment profile, characterized by significant land-value appreciation and a focus on independent housing. Delta 1 has witnessed a 90% growth in prices, supported by its proximity to the Wipro Knowledge Park and major employment hubs. Residential plots in this sector are currently valued between ₹1.5 crore and ₹4.6 crore, catering to buyers seeking personalized construction within a planned urban framework.

Gamma 1 and Gamma 2 continue to show strong performance, with Gamma 1 recording a 110% appreciation in land rates. The average property rate for land in this micro-market has stabilized around ₹14,700 per sq ft. Residents in these sectors benefit from reduced traffic congestion and immediate access to the Jagat Plaza market and the Aqua Line metro network. The residential demand in Greater Noida is increasingly migrating toward these sectors as they offer a balanced price-to-amenity ratio. Connectivity and the Jewar Airport Strategic Impact

The strategic roadmap for Greater Noida property investment is now indelibly linked to the global aviation map. The Phase 1 operationalization of Jewar Airport by the end of March 2026 is expected to trigger a secondary wave of price hikes, particularly in the sectors flanking the Yamuna Expressway. This infrastructure milestone is complemented by the Eastern Peripheral Expressway, which links the city to industrial clusters in Haryana and Rajasthan. Metro expansion remains a critical driver for last-mile connectivity. The integration of the Aqua Line with the Delhi Metro Blue Line is anticipated to reduce commute times to central business districts by approximately 25%. Outlook

Through FY2026 and into FY2027, the Greater Noida market is projected to maintain its upward trajectory. The shift from speculative plot trading to end-user-driven apartment demand signals a maturing market. Investors should monitor the progress of the Aqua Line extension deeper into Greater Noida West, as this will likely create new value pockets.
